Abstract:
According to the present invention an HVAC system is provided. The HVAC system includes a heat exchanger containing a cooling fluid to be circulated, a blower assembly configured to generate an inlet air stream through said heat exchanger, and a kinetic energy storage device. The blower assembly is powered by an external electrical power supply. The kinetic energy storage device is configured to provide auxiliary power to the blower assembly in the event of an interruption of the external electrical power supply.
